Tearing out my hair on this one...

A few months ago, a new kernel caused printing to freeze the system,
but I don't think that's related (have tried all BIOS settings;
one-way, ECP, EPP).

The first symptom was (your not going to believe it) Firefox tabs quit
responding to the mouse. (That seemed to be fixed after replacing the
motherboard... but, I'm getting ahead of the story.)

System started hanging a few weeks ago. No error messages... just
hangs tight. I was playing w/ some new hardware and had to
power-cycle a lot, so I figured I killed some HW.

I removed a processor... didn't fix it; replaced the running
processor, with the one I took out... didn't fix it.

I tried running one stick of RAM at a time... didn't fix it.

Removed all peripherals, swapped video cards, disabled USB, printer,
and serial in the BIOS, replaced the SCSI card, replaced SCSI w/ IDE
(same image)... didn't fix it.

Replaced the motherboard, with new processors... didn't fix it.

Put all the PCI adapters/devices/video disks on a newer Intel
motherboard... it works... no hangs!


Did you change the power supply?
